Job summary

To provide secretarial and administrative support to the team. To undertake responsibility for the day to day management of the administrative, clerical and secretarial functions. This includes working and acting on own initiative and dealing with potentiallycomplex situations. To consistently deliver a client focussed service, which promotes good customer service and effective working relationships.

Main duties of the job

Applicants should have excellent communication skills, as well as experience of Microsoft Office. Have a pleasant telephone manner and a helpful and flexible attitude is essential, as you will be dealing with patients, carers and personal visitors to the ward as well as telephone calls and enquiries from the general public, patients, relatives and professional/clinical staff.Your main duties will be providing administrative support to the team; liaising with the mental health act office, managing diaries, organising workload, typing minutes of patient reviews and other multidisciplinary meetings. Your role will also include a wide range of administrative duties and you will also be required to provide administrative support to the wards and cover colleagues during periods of leave.

About us

78 Crawley Road is a high dependency rehabilitation unit, based in Horsham, with an innovative design which provides 8 beds and 16 individual recovery flats. The service provides treatment and care for patients with complex needs who may be detained under the Mental Health Act, and employs a full multidisciplinary team.

Job description

Job responsibilities

To work directly with the team, providing a comprehensive and highly efficient secretarial and administrative support service. To be responsible for appointment booking, complex diary management and robust filing systems, adhering to the Trust policies of file management. Deal with telephone enquiries from a broad spectrum of people, including service users and their carers, staff at all levels both from within and outside of the Trust and external agencies, contact with service users, their carers and advocates and relatives. To provide excellent administrative and secretarial support, working to stricttimescales and to a very high standard of accuracy. To provide a personal assistant service to the multidisciplinary team. Organise and arrange service users reviews and make necessary arrangements for meetings and take accurate minutes. To maintain electronic service user records in order that all information is up to date. To be proactive in organising and prioritising workload, managing own time effectively, highlighting problems as they arise. To take minutes as and when necessary. To photocopy and distribute documents both internally and externally as required. To carry out other general office duties. To liaise with GPs, mental health services and other appropriate agencies or individuals with regard to service user issues. To provide cover for other secretarial and administrative staff as appropriate. To support cashier with reimbursement of any appropriate petty cash to service users and team. To organise the ordering of any essential equipment / supplies for the team, as and when necessary.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
